Sometimes mines are named after their owner, a local town, or perhaps a landmark, but how many can lay claim to being named after a mineralogical feature such as blue balls of Azurite - well Blue Ball mine at Globe in Arizona can! This two-part specimen - a split geode of Azurite - is a classic from Blue Ball mine and reminds me a lot of fossil collecting where you collect the part and counterpart pieces of a fossil. Here it is the two halves of the geode. Combined, the two parts make a thumbnail specimen, but it displays wonderful texture with a rough crystallized dark blue outer edge, paler blue internal zone and central dark blue glossy crystal-lined vug.
